190 | /**\r |
191 | This function computes and returns the width of the Unicode character\r |
192 | specified by UnicodeChar.\r |
193 | \r |
194 | @param UnicodeChar A Unicode character.\r |
195 | \r |
196 | @retval 0 The width if UnicodeChar could not be determined.\r |
197 | @retval 1 UnicodeChar is a narrow glyph.\r |
198 | @retval 2 UnicodeChar is a wide glyph.\r |
199 | \r |
200 | **/\r |
201 | UINTN\r |
202 | EFIAPI\r |
203 | GetGlyphWidth (\r |
204 | IN CHAR16 UnicodeChar\r |
205 | )\r |
206 | {\r |
207 | UINTN Index;\r |
208 | UINTN Low;\r |
209 | UINTN High;\r |
210 | UNICODE_WIDTH_ENTRY *Item;\r |
211 | \r |
212 | Item = NULL;\r |
213 | Low = 0;\r |
214 | High = (sizeof (mUnicodeWidthTable)) / (sizeof (UNICODE_WIDTH_ENTRY)) - 1;\r |
215 | while (Low <= High) {\r |
216 | Index = (Low + High) >> 1;\r |
217 | Item = &(mUnicodeWidthTable[Index]);\r |
218 | if (Index == 0) {\r |
219 | if (UnicodeChar <= Item->WChar) {\r |
220 | break;\r |
221 | }\r |
222 | \r |
223 | return 0;\r |
224 | }\r |
225 | \r |
226 | if (UnicodeChar > Item->WChar) {\r |
227 | Low = Index + 1;\r |
228 | } else if (UnicodeChar <= mUnicodeWidthTable[Index - 1].WChar) {\r |
229 | High = Index - 1;\r |
230 | } else {\r |
231 | //\r |
232 | // Index - 1 < UnicodeChar <= Index. Found\r |
233 | //\r |
234 | break;\r |
235 | }\r |
236 | }\r |
237 | \r |
238 | if (Low <= High) {\r |
239 | return Item->Width;\r |
240 | }\r |
241 | \r |
242 | return 0;\r |
243 | }\r |

245 | /**\r |
246 | This function computes and returns the display length of\r |
247 | the Null-terminated Unicode string specified by String.\r |
248 | If String is NULL, then 0 is returned.\r |
249 | If any of the widths of the Unicode characters in String\r |
250 | can not be determined, then 0 is returned.\r |
251 | \r |
252 | @param String A pointer to a Null-terminated Unicode string.\r |
253 | \r |
254 | @return The display length of the Null-terminated Unicode string specified by String.\r |
255 | \r |
256 | **/\r |
257 | UINTN\r |
258 | EFIAPI\r |
259 | UnicodeStringDisplayLength (\r |
260 | IN CONST CHAR16 *String\r |
261 | )\r |
262 | {\r |
263 | UINTN Length;\r |
264 | UINTN Width;\r |
265 | \r |
266 | if (String == NULL) {\r |
267 | return 0;\r |
268 | }\r |
269 | \r |
270 | Length = 0;\r |
271 | while (*String != 0) {\r |
272 | Width = GetGlyphWidth (*String);\r |
273 | if (Width == 0) {\r |
274 | return 0;\r |
275 | }\r |
276 | \r |
277 | Length += Width;\r |
278 | String++;\r |
279 | }\r |
280 | \r |
281 | return Length;\r |
282 | }\r |
